KRS § 65.7637 Limitations of liability for CMRS providers, service suppliers, VoIP service providers, and 911 or next generation 911 system services or equipment providers.

Certain 911-related providers and their personnel are generally protected from civil damages and criminal prosecution, except for negligence, wanton or willful misconduct, or bad faith.
